Types of Football Pad Pants: Finding the Right Fit

So, you’re ready to gear up and hit the field? Awesome! But before you grab the first pair of football pad pants you see, let’s talk about the different types and how to find the perfect fit. There’s no one-size-fits-all solution, and understanding the variations will help you choose the best option for your position and playing style. First up, we have integrated pad pants. These are the most common type and come with built-in padding for the hips, thighs, and tailbone. They're super convenient, as everything is in one place, saving you time and hassle. Then, there are girdle-style pants, which offer a more snug and streamlined fit. They often include a pocket for a cup and can provide extra support. Next, we’ve got shell-style pants, which are designed to be worn over separate pads. These are great if you prefer to customize your padding configuration. Now, let’s move on to the fit. The fit is crucial, guys! You want your pants to be snug but not restrictive. They should stay in place during intense movements and provide full coverage without bunching or shifting. The size charts will be your best friend. Always measure your waist and hips and follow the manufacturer’s guidelines. Pay attention to the length; you don't want the pads to interfere with your knee pads. Consider the material and the cut too. Breathable, moisture-wicking fabrics are a must for comfort, and the cut should allow for a full range of motion. Remember, the right fit is the foundation for both protection and performance. Taking your time to find the perfect pair of football pad pants will pay off big time on the field!

Proper Care and Maintenance of Your Football Pad Pants

Alright, so you've got your awesome new football pad pants! Now, let’s talk about keeping them in tip-top shape. Proper care and maintenance will not only extend their lifespan but also ensure they continue to provide the protection you need. First things first, always follow the manufacturer’s washing instructions. Generally, you’ll want to wash your pants in cold water with mild detergent. Avoid using bleach or harsh chemicals, as they can damage the fabric and padding. After washing, let your pants air dry. Avoid using a dryer, as the heat can degrade the padding and cause shrinkage. Inspect your pants regularly for any signs of wear and tear, such as rips, tears, or damage to the padding. Address any issues promptly. If you find a small tear, you can often repair it with a needle and thread. Consider using a fabric sealant to reinforce the area. Proper storage is also crucial. Store your football pad pants in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Make sure they are completely dry before storing them to prevent mildew or odors. Periodically check the padding for compression or degradation. If the padding feels flattened or less effective, it might be time to replace your pants. Regular maintenance will keep your gear ready for action. By following these simple tips, you can extend the life of your football pad pants and ensure they're always ready to protect you on the field. Remember, taking care of your gear is an investment in your safety and performance!

Choosing the Right Football Pad Pants: A Step-by-Step Guide

Okay, time to put your knowledge to the test!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you choose the right football pad pants. First, determine your needs. Consider your position and playing style. Linemen might need extra protection in the thighs and hips, while skill position players may prioritize flexibility. Next, measure your waist and hips accurately. Follow the manufacturer's sizing chart. Don’t guess, measuring is key! Research different brands and models. Read reviews and compare features. Look for pants with the features we discussed earlier – impact-absorbing padding, breathable fabrics, and a snug but comfortable fit. Try on the pants, if possible. Walk around, do some squats, and simulate football movements. Make sure the pants stay in place and don’t restrict your range of motion. Pay attention to the padding coverage and ensure it protects the areas most vulnerable to injury. Consider the price and your budget. Quality football pad pants are an investment, but you don't have to break the bank. Compare prices and look for sales or discounts. By following these steps, you can confidently choose a pair of football pad pants that fit your needs, provide excellent protection, and enhance your performance. Remember, taking the time to find the right gear is an important part of playing the game safely and successfully. You’re now well-equipped to make an informed decision and gear up like a pro!
